Boon Chew
Turbo S (2014)
Bought new, Owned for 2 Years
Fuel Economy: 11.0 km/litre (9.1 L/100 km), RON95, Mileage: 3,500 km/month
    I like the look and the stability of this car. Fuel efficiency is very good for a D segment car. Highway cruising at 110kmph burn 60L Ron 95 for 900km. Normal mixed driving range at 650km for 60L. Sufficient power and torque for a careful driver like me who like smooth sailing.
    Sound proof could be better particularly during raining. GPS user interface is not so friendly. No touch screen, data entry is very troublesome and data searching is rather inconvenient due to segmentation problem.
To Improve
Rear leg room could be improved particularly in the middle of the rear seat.
Yes, I would recommend this car

EE
Premium (2014)
Bought new, Owned for 1 Year
Fuel Economy: 8.0 km/litre (12.5 L/100 km), RON97, Mileage: 1,500 km/month
    First of all, being a 1.6l turbocharged car, I was quite impressed of how the heavy Pug is being accelerated from standstill. I love how the centre "i-drive" system was laid out. The stylish and sleek interior never failed to impress me and many of my friends. Besides, the 10 JBL HIFI system that are built in are adequate enough to take care of your ears. What has received many envious from other owners is the Head Up Display (HUD) system where it is only available at some higher premium vehicles. Besides, the vehicle is also well insulated against the engine noise that you will have a sudden thought of driving a hybrid. Given the money forked out, I myself can assure that the features and build quality that comes with will worth every penny you spent! Ohh, did I mentioned that the Peugeot 508 is the among very few D-Segment car that offers quad zone air conditioning at this price?
    Despite the decent build quality, the rear speaker board casing tend to crack easily. This creates unwanted squeeky sound when crossing the uneven road. However not to worry because it is covered under the warranty programme. The down side was the rear windshield doesn't comes in auto.
To Improve
The gear shift should be improved to more instaneous feel.
Yes, I would recommend this car
